Alsip Man, 36, ID'ed As Victim In Fatal Tinley Park Crash

The two-vehicle crash, involving a car and a motorcycle, happened Friday around 6 p.m. in the 7400 block of 183rd Street.

TINLEY PARK, IL — A 36-year-old Alsip man has been identified as the motorcyclist killed in a two-vehicle crash Friday evening in Tinley Park.

Ryan M. Albores, 36, died in the collision, the Cook County Medical Examiner's Office said Monday.

Police said the crash happened around 6 p.m. in the 7400 block of 183rd Street, police said. Police were still investigating as of Saturday morning. Further details have not yet been released.

Editor's Note: The Cook County Medical Examiner's Office previously identified Albores as being from Oak Forest. They have since revised that to Alsip. We have made the correction to reflect that.
